Julep | December/January Maven Boxes

Picture
     I've got a LOT of Julep polishes to share with you today, two months worth with several add ons! I will have a separate post with the lippies when I review them so stay tuned for those swatches. But here are a whole bunch of colours to share, let me know which one(s) are you favourite!
Picture
     So for Decembers Maven box, I splurged with my Jules and upgraded to get a couple extra polishes and two of the It's Whipped lippies. This is the first time I've ever purchased "makeup" from Julep. If you guys have watched my Maven videos for any length of time you'll have heard me say many times that I'm just going to stick to polishes. But since everyone and their mothers' have released matte (liquid) lipsticks I thought, why not try these (and perhaps do a comparison with my others). 
 
    The polishes that I have here are:
Katie: Orchid iridescent chrome 
​
Omelia: Sparkling sugarplum stardust
Chrissy: 
Deep Teal crème
Beatrice: Golden ember iridescent chrome
Cheyenne: Auburn matte metallic
Picture
Top: Natural Light // Bottom: With Flash
​L-R: Katie, Omelia, Chrissy, Beatrice, Cheyenne
Picture
     For January, I was slightly disappointed because (if you've followed my Julep adventure for any length of time) I got another light pink...wwhhhhhyyyyy?! The It Girl is suppose to have funky colours, I think these light pinks belong to another box style, but I LOVE the holo polish. It's GORGEOUS. I could have also lived without the nail therapy polish since I have a few already, and I actually thought I already owned it but apparently I don't. We also got a set of nail tattoos which I'm intrigued by. I've never use nail tats before, but I love the way they look! They have 10 nails and two french tip accents so you can mix up how you want to use the designs. 

​     The polishes are:
​Tali: Glacier breeze linear liquid holographic
Janie: Whisper pink sheer crème
